Jacksonville, FL – Car Crash at N Davis St & 8th St W

Jacksonville, FL (February 5, 2020) – On Tuesday afternoon, February 4, a serious car crash that hospitalized multiple victims took place at the intersection of North Davis Street and 8th Street West.

The Jacksonville Fire and Rescue Department responded to the scene with police and assisted multiple victims with their injuries. One person was trapped inside their vehicle and had to be rescued.

Police did not comment on how many vehicles were involved but it is known that more than two collided. One lane of westbound 8th Street was blocked.

The investigation into the accident continues at this time.
